Desbloqueando o Potencial do Magento 2: As Principais Ferramentas de Desenvolvedor para Elevar Sua Loja Online

Tabela de Conteúdo

  1. Introdução
  2. Desenvolvimento Magento 2: Um Transformador para o eCommerce
  3. Ferramentas Essenciais de Desenvolvedor Magento 2
  4. Conclusão

Introdução

Você já se perguntou sobre a espinha dorsal de um site de comércio eletrônico que funciona perfeitamente, atraindo clientes e garantindo vendas sem problemas? Nos bastidores, uma plataforma robusta como o Magento 2 e um conjunto de ferramentas de desenvolvedor estão em ação, garantindo que sua loja online não apenas funcione de forma eficiente, mas também ofereça uma experiência do usuário excepcional. Com o cenário do comércio digital evoluindo rapidamente, o Magento 2 se destaca como um farol para empresas que visam criar uma loja online poderosa e adaptável. Neste post, exploramos as oito ferramentas essenciais de desenvolvimento Magento 2 que estão revolucionando como os desenvolvedores constroem, gerenciam e otimizam os sites de comércio eletrônico. Seja você um desenvolvedor experiente ou novo na plataforma Magento, essas ferramentas prometem aprimorar seu fluxo de trabalho, elevar a funcionalidade de sua loja e mantê-lo à frente no competitivo domínio do comércio eletrônico.

Desenvolvimento Magento 2: Um Transformador para o eCommerce

O desenvolvimento de comércio eletrônico nunca foi algo padronizado. Requer uma combinação de planejamento estratégico, proficiência técnica e uma compreensão profunda dos comportamentos de compra do cliente. O Magento 2, com seu extenso catálogo de 224+ extensões, se destaca como um testemunho da flexibilidade e escalabilidade no campo do comércio eletrônico. A plataforma serve como uma base sólida para lojas online de diversos tamanhos e setores, facilitando experiências de compra excepcionais.

Ferramentas Essenciais de Desenvolvedor Magento 2

1. Magento Debug

Simplificar a complexidade dos scripts é essencial no desenvolvimento de eCommerce, e é aí que Magento Debug se destaca. Ele ajuda os desenvolvedores a identificar e resolver problemas na loja de forma proativa, garantindo a experiência do cliente e o desempenho do sistema. Sua semelhança com a barra de ferramentas de desenvolvimento do Magento, embora com uma aparência renovada, garante familiaridade e facilidade de uso.

2. PHPStorm

PHPStorm eleva a eficiência de codificação, oferecendo recursos de autocompletar código e navegação perfeita. Sua especialização em lidar com múltiplos projetos de comércio eletrônico simultaneamente o torna a principal escolha dos desenvolvedores do Magento. A integração da ferramenta com o Magento 2 garante que os desenvolvedores possam manter a alta qualidade de código sem comprometer os cronogramas do projeto.

3. MageTools

Para desenvolvedores que buscam simplificar tarefas repetitivas e aumentar a eficiência, MageTools se destaca. Essa ferramenta é inestimável para criar websites do Magento com Zend, facilitando um processo de desenvolvimento mais suave por meio de uma variedade de recursos projetados para acelerar configurações e migrações de dados.

4. Xdebug

Depurar é uma parte inevitável do desenvolvimento, e Xdebug oferece uma solução abrangente. Seus recursos, como funcionalidade avançada de var_dump() e inserção de pontos de interrupção, tornam a resolução de problemas de código significativamente mais gerenciável, melhorando assim o fluxo e a eficiência do desenvolvimento.

5. Git

Git incorpora a essência do controle de versão, fornecendo uma plataforma robusta para o gerenciamento de código. Sua natureza distribuída garante que os desenvolvedores possam trabalhar de forma colaborativa e eficiente, tornando-o uma ferramenta indispensável para sites de comércio eletrônico da Adobe que dependem da infraestrutura na nuvem.

6. EcomDev PHPUnit

Os testes de integração se tornam fáceis com o EcomDev PHPUnit. Essa extensão do Magento facilita o desenvolvimento orientado a testes, permitindo um processo de codificação mais estruturado e confiável. Ao permitir testes eficientes para diferentes componentes do Magento, garante que os desenvolvedores possam entregar um código livre de erros mais rapidamente.

7. Magento Stack Exchange

Embora não seja uma ferramenta no sentido tradicional, Magento Stack Exchange é um tesouro de insights e soluções oferecidos pela comunidade de desenvolvedores do Magento. Atua como uma plataforma para resolver problemas, onde os desenvolvedores podem buscar respostas para desafios específicos encontrados durante o desenvolvimento.

8. Dicas de Caminhos de Templates Facilitadas

A ferramenta Dicas de Caminhos de Templates Facilitadas é uma bênção para desenvolvedores que desejam ajustar a estética da loja. Ela simplifica a tarefa de localizar e alinhar arquivos de template com o tema, agilizando o processo de desenvolvimento tanto para a frente quanto para o backend das lojas Magento.

Conclusão

À medida que o comércio eletrônico continua a evoluir, o Magento 2 e a infinidade de ferramentas de desenvolvedor disponíveis desempenham um papel crítico na definição do futuro das lojas online. Essas ferramentas não apenas aprimoram o processo de desenvolvimento, mas também garantem que os sites de comércio eletrônico possam se adaptar às demandas em constante mudança do mercado digital. Ao aproveitar esses recursos, os desenvolvedores do Magento estão equipados para criar lojas online que não apenas atendam, mas superem as expectativas dos clientes, impulsionando o crescimento e a inovação nos negócios.

Ao olharmos para o futuro, a integração dessas ferramentas nos fluxos de desenvolvimento do Magento 2 certamente levará a avanços na tecnologia de comércio eletrônico, estabelecendo novos padrões para experiências de compras online. Abraçe essas ferramentas, aprimore suas habilidades e abra as portas para novas possibilidades no campo da excelência em comércio eletrônico.

Seção de Perguntas Frequentes

P: Iniciantes podem usar eficientemente essas ferramentas de desenvolvimento do Magento 2? R: Absolutamente, a maioria dessas ferramentas vem com documentação abrangente e suporte da comunidade, o que as torna acessíveis para iniciantes. No entanto, é recomendável ter uma compreensão básica do Magento e princípios de codificação para uso ideal.

P: Como as ferramentas de desenvolvedor impactam o desempenho de uma loja Magento 2? R: As ferramentas de desenvolvedor aprimoram principalmente o processo de desenvolvimento, levando a um código mais eficiente e fluxos de trabalho mais simplificados. Isso impacta indiretamente o desempenho da loja, reduzindo bugs, melhorando os tempos de carregamento e garantindo uma experiência do usuário mais suave.

P: Existem custos associados ao uso dessas ferramentas de desenvolvedor do Magento 2? R: Algumas ferramentas, como o PHPStorm, exigem uma assinatura, enquanto outras são de código aberto e gratuitas. É importante revisar os detalhes de licenciamento e os custos associados a cada ferramenta antes de incorporá-las em seu processo de desenvolvimento.

P: Como o Magento Stack Exchange difere de outros fóruns de desenvolvedores? R: O Magento Stack Exchange é especificamente voltado para desenvolvedores do Magento, oferecendo uma plataforma focada na resolução de problemas, troca de conhecimento e discussão de desafios de desenvolvimento específicos do Magento.

P: Essas ferramentas podem ser usadas tanto nas edições Comunitária quanto Enterprise do Magento 2? R: Sim, a maioria dessas ferramentas é compatível com ambas as edições do Magento 2, garantindo que os desenvolvedores que trabalham em várias versões da plataforma possam se beneficiar de seus recursos.